
Senior Ryan Pidgeon of the Roanoke College men’s soccer team has been selected as the Old Dominion Athletic Conference (ODAC) Offensive Player of the Week.
Pidgeon takes home the honor after two standout performances last week to help the Maroons go 2-0 for the week and 6-1 overall. The midfielder scored the game winner and only goal in a 1-0 win against William Peace in the final minute of RC’s midweek contest. Then, on Saturday, he tallied two goals, including the game-winner, against Penn State Abington as the Maroons pitched another shutout, 2-0.
Aidan McHugh played all 90 minutes in net and registered five saves on the afternoon for his second consecutive clean sheet.
This is the first time in his career that Pidgeon has won a weekly accolade. It is also the first time this season that Roanoke has picked up a weekly award.
